I doubt that's true. "Gone gold" means the game is finished and the final CD is sent to manufacturer for duplication.

Usually a game goes gold a week or two before the release date. Civ4 is coming out in late October (assuming the 25th), so we are still like 6 weeks away from the release date.

Well, once they decided upon a release date, wont mean they will release the game earlier just cus it went gold.

To someone outside the gaming industry it might seem reasonable to release it as fast as possible, but timing the release is very important nowadays. The two biggest markets is the christmas and summer market, and they dont want to outcompete other releases from the same producer, or release at the same time as another similar game they think might steal the glory.
